Among the innovative designs of military drones is the flying wing UAV, a futuristic aircraft that is shaped like a delta wing without a traditional fuselage. This design reduces drag, increases aerodynamic efficiency, and allows for greater maneuverability and stability during flight. Flying wing UAVs are used for a variety of purposes, including surveillance, reconnaissance, and target acquisition.

The use of military drones has also sparked debates regarding the ethical implications of remote warfare. Critics argue that the use of drones can lead to an increase in civilian casualties and raise concerns about accountability and transparency. The remote nature of drone warfare can desensitize operators to the human cost of their actions, potentially undermining the moral fabric of warfare.

On the legal front, the use of military drones has raised questions about sovereignty and the rules of engagement. Drone strikes in countries without the consent of their governments have sparked international outrage and fueled debates about the legality of targeted killings. The blurred boundaries of modern warfare have forced policymakers to reconsider existing laws and norms governing armed conflict.
